The annual Memorial Day Ceremony in Moscow will take place on Monday morning at 11:00 at the Latah County Fairgrounds. The event is organized by local American Legion and VFW posts, and the Moscow High School band will perform.
Memorial Day ceremonies are scheduled in several communities in Whitman County on Monday morning. A ceremony will take place at the VFW Memorial in Colfax at 10:00 AM. The Garfield ceremony is set for 11:00 AM at the local cemetery. Additionally, the Colton/Uniontown ceremony will begin at 10:00 AM at the Colton cemetery.

Washington State University will host a wreath-laying ceremony on campus in recognition of Memorial Day on Friday morning. The ceremony is scheduled for 11:00 AM at the Veteran’s Memorial on campus.
The Annual Kendrick Locust Blossom Festival takes place on Saturday. The schedule begins with a color run at 7:30, followed by a parade at 10:00. Afternoon activities in Kendrick include a BBQ beef sandwich lunch, live music, an egg toss, and a dunk tank.
Government offices will be closed on Monday in observance of Memorial Day. Trash collection will not occur on that day. Banks will also be closed. Pullman Transit will operate on a reduced route bus service, while there will be no bus service in Moscow on Monday.
Boat races are scheduled to take place in Elk River this weekend. The Stateline Outboard Racing Association’s Memorial Day Weekend Regatta will occur on Saturday and Sunday. Racing on Elk Creek Reservoir is set to begin at 11:00. The Elk River Volunteer Fire Department will be providing hamburgers for attendees.
Palouse Habitat for Humanity’s ReStore in Moscow is hosting a Memorial Day sale this weekend with a 50% discount. The sale will take place from 10:00 AM to 5:00 PM on Saturday at the store located on North Main Street.
The Latah County Sheriff’s Office is investigating an incident of graffiti vandalism on the trail east of Moscow. The graffiti is located near the landfill along the Latah Trail. Individuals with information regarding this incident are encouraged to reach out to the sheriff’s office in Moscow.
